Relaxation exercise
Use this tool to ease your burgeoning stress level and help bring balance to your life.

- Realize on the count of three youâll relax and release your stress.

- Take a deep breath in from your nose. Release it slowly from your mouth and close your eyes.
- Press your thumb and forefinger together to form a circle (an "OK" sign). When you count, "Three," feel your whole body relax. Count slowly "One ... two ... three." When you reach "three," relax.
- Release yourself into a deep state of relaxation. Release your stress, relax your muscles, and go limp like a rag doll.
- Say positive statements or just sit quietly.
- To reawaken, release your fingers and open your eyes.
Source: Susan Gayle, CH, founder of the New Behavior Institute in New York
